What is Phenothalin?

Phenothalin, a compound that belongs to the phenol family, is quite the chameleon in the world of chemistry. It’s often used as a pH indicator in laboratories. You know, that nifty little tool that helps scientists determine the acidity or alkalinity of a solution? Yep, that’s Phenothalin doing its magic! When added to a solution, it changes color depending on the pH level, making it easier for researchers to make informed decisions.

How Does It Work?

So, how does this little wonder work its magic? When the pH level of a solution changes, Phenothalin shifts from colorless to pink. This transition occurs at a pH of around 8.2 to 10.0. Pretty cool, right? It’s like watching a live performance where the chemistry unfolds in front of your eyes!
